SPAIN / Sunseed Desert Project

Sunseed is based in a beautiful village in southern Spain. We aim to develop, demonstrate and communicate accessible low-tech methods of living sustainably in a semi-arid environment. We are a UK charity and a Spanish Association.

We are a friendly international low-impact community, living off-grid (limited access to mod cons) and with delicious vegetarian/vegan food. Volunteers make a weekly contribution towards food and accommodation (between 85€ and 115€ depending on length of stay).

Short and longer-term volunteers are required year round for working, learning new skills and joining in with communal activities. Volunteers can work in areas such as: Organic Growing, Dryland Regeneration, Appropriate Technology, Eco-Construction and Maintenance, Environmental Education and Sustainable Living.

During the week we include activities such as:

* seminars
* live music (jam)sessions
* bread-making
* guided tours of the different departments,
* Spanish lessons,
* film night (documentaries etc)
* visits to other projects,
* Open Space for skill-sharing

Longer-term volunteers may qualify for European funding (Erasmus, Leonardo), and may come to Sunseed as part of a university course – for research, a thesis or a dissertation.

Leisure activities here include trips to the beach (Natural Park Cabo de Gata), local trips (walking, cycling, climbing), swimming (in the local rock pools), caving and many other possibilities.
